DrugBust Posted June 4, 2001 Posted June 4, 2001 Do the access privileges I make in my database for multiple groups and passwords still work when I use the Web Security Database? They don't seem to...
dspires Posted June 4, 2001 Posted June 4, 2001 You can configure the Web Companion to use either the Web Security Database or the FileMaker Pro Access Privileges (Preferences/Application/Plugins).
DrugBust Posted June 4, 2001 Author Posted June 4, 2001 The thing I liked about the Web Security Database was the password protection on-line. So when they clicked on a database a pop up window came up asking for a password. Will filemaker do the same? I can't seem to get that working.
Vaughan Posted June 5, 2001 Posted June 5, 2001 If web companion is configured to use FileMaker access prvileges (and not web security) then users will be prompted for a *password* only. The browser authentication box has a field for usename, but FMP ignors it and only checks the password. Note that if the database has a <no password> defined, the browser won;t ask for a password to browse the database.
